Market Implications of Increased High-Frequency Trading
The growing presence of high-frequency traders in the currency options space is likely to have significant implications for the entire market. The increased competition may lead to tighter spreads and improved prices for traders. However, it also raises concerns about market volatility and the risks associated with algorithmic trading.
Potential Risks and Challenges
- Market Volatility: The rapid execution of trades can lead to sudden market movements, creating opportunities but also risks.
- Regulatory Scrutiny: As high-frequency trading gains popularity, regulators are likely to increase oversight to ensure market integrity.
- Technological Dependence: Heavy reliance on technology may expose traders to risks associated with system failures or cybersecurity threats.
